Size
There is a sectional with recliners to fit any size space. Many models feature zero clearance designs, which allows you to place the sofas within inches of a brick wall, without sacrificing functionality or comfort. This feature is particularly beneficial for those with lower back pain. Other models come with adjustable power lumbar that can provide an individualized level of assistance.

Capacity for Seating
Sectional sofas that recline provide seating for a larger number of people than traditional sofas. They are ideal for families and those who regularly entertain guests. They can seat up to 10 people comfortably. Some models have built-in reclining features which allow you to alter the seating position of each. These reclining sofas are offered in a wide range of shapes and sizes, making it easy to find one that is suitable for your space and meets your requirements.
A lot of sectional sofas come with a chaise at the end. This can provide additional seating as well as the opportunity to kick your feet up. Some sectionals have power-reclining options that allow you to recline at the push of a single button. These reclining sofas are ideal for families that want to spend time together or anyone who would like to unwind after a long day.
In addition to offering plenty of seating, sectional sofas with recliners can also help define spaces in an open floor plan. They are typically available in L-shaped designs and can be placed in various configurations to suit your space. Some come with left-arm facing and right-arm facing sections. others are curving and can be placed in the center of the room.

Comfort
A sectional sofa with a reclining feature lets you sit back in comfort and relax your feet, which is ideal to relax or watch TV. Sectionals come in different shapes, sizes and colors and can be upholstered with leather or fabric. They also offer many options like storage, USB ports and power recline. When shopping for a sectional, think about your needs and preferences to choose the right one for your home.
Sectionals can comfortably seat up to three people. They're particularly helpful in homes with large families, or those who frequently host guests. A reclined sectional is great for watching films or sporting events with your loved ones.
You can choose between a variety of sectional shapes including L-shaped or U-shaped. A U-shaped sofa consists of three sections, while an L-shaped sofa is comprised of two sections. Certain models let you set the individual seats with options of left-arm facing or facing right-arm. This is a great option for couples or groups of friends that want to enjoy a relaxing time but still have privacy.
You can also find reclining sectionals with chaise lounges that provide extra space for stretching out or kicking up your feet. For more comfort look for sofas that offer adjustable headrests and comfortable cushions. You can choose a sofa with USB ports built-in to allow you to charge your devices while you're reclined. Certain sofas require a minimum of 10 inches of clearance from the wall to fully recline, so it's important to measure and scale your space prior to buying.
